Directions
1. In a large pot, heat the olive oil over medium heat. Add the sliced sausage and cook until browned, about 5 minutes.
2. Add the chopped onion and minced garlic to the pot, sautéing until the onion is translucent.
3. Stir in the chopped cabbage, cooking until it begins to soften, about 5 minutes.
4. Pour in the chicken broth and add the bay leaf.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
5. Bring the mixture to a simmer, cover, and cook for 20 minutes.
6. Add the frozen pierogi to the pot, stirring gently to combine.
7. Cover and simmer for an additional 10-12 minutes, or until the pierogi are heated through.
8. Remove the bay leaf, stir in the fresh dill, and serve hot.
